ESPN College Football analyst Mark Schlabach is reporting that Georgia has fired Mark Richt after 15 season as head coach. The Bulldogs went 9-3 this season after beating rival Georgia Tech on Saturday in Atlanta.

His all-time record at Georgia is 145-51 (83-37 SEC).

Schlabach is also reporting that Richt has agreed to coach the Bulldogs in a bowl game.
